Danakil desert (Ethiopia)
14 days expedition to Erta Ale volcano and Dallol hydrothermal field (Danakil desert, Ethiopia)
Experience one of the geologically most active areas on the planet! The Danakil desert is famous for Erta Ale, one of the world´s few permanently active volcanoes. Until 2017, it hosted a spectacular boiling lava lake, which is now gradually returning (as of late 2020). Don't miss your chance to see the surreal landscapes of colors, salt, geysers and hot springs at the hydrothermal area of Dallol.
See the dramatic change of environment when the jeep expedition starts in Addis Ababa (at 2355 m), and gradually descents into the Danakil depression, passing through Awash National Park before reaching the banks of Afrera salt lake (at - 100 m). The journey continues as we climb Erta Ale shield volcano and spend 3 full days and nights exploring the volcano´s caldera. We then set up camp at the Afar village of Hamed Ela and have 2 full days to discover the hydrothermal area of Dallol and Assale salt lake, including the centuries-old ritual of salt cutting. Finally explore the UNESCO world heritage site of the rock hewn churches of Lalibela.

Danakil desert + Semien Mountains (Ethiopia)
15 days expedition and trekking to Erta Ale volcano, Dallol, Lalibela and Semien mountains (Ethiopia)
A tour which combines 2 different natural phenomena: Danakil Depression (the lowest place - 125 m below the sea level) and Semien Mountains («the roof of Africa” with the highest elevation of 4620m, Mount Ras Dashen). Both of them are the parts of Great Rift Valley with the same geological process: the result of Plate Tectonic process which dates back to 30 million years.
During the trip we spend 4 days in Danakil Depression (which is the result of the triple plate margins in the Northeastern part of Ethiopia and yet is still active) visiting active volcano Erta Ale (with the possibility to see some activity inside the crater), Dallol volcano with its fascinating fumaroles, amazing rock formations, crystal and mineral deposits. At the miners' town of Ahmed Ela near Lake Assale we'll watch the centuries-old ritual of salt cutting, the shaping of salt blocks and the endless caravans arriving and leaving loaded with the precious "white gold".
In the Semien Mountains (which is the result of the destruction of shield volcanoes into numerous peaks and now the UNESCO world heritage site) we also spend 4 days enjoying the most spectacular mountain scenery, climbing the second high mountain Mount Bahwit (4,430m), meeting animals like the Gelada, the Ethiopian wolf, the Walia ibex, the giant Lammergeir) .
